[2009-12-18 11:02:08] s...@php.net

Automatic comment from SVN on behalf of jani
Revision: http://svn.php.net/viewvc/?view=revision&revision=292283
Log: - Fixed bug #50508 (compile fails: Conflicting HEADER type
declarations)
# NEVER ever include nameser_compat.h, it's included in various ways in
different OSes by nameser.h if needed
